    Job Summary



    Summary: Responsible for receiving, storage and inventory of all departmental supplies and food stuffs, along with maintaining sanitation in storage areas.

    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

    Inventories and maintains necessary food and other supplies to ensure efficient operation of the Food Service Department. Stores food and supplies in correct containers and in proper storage areas according to department guidelines as indicated by non-spoilage of food. Maintains records and logs documenting storage temperatures of perishable food items per standards. Dates, labels, and rotates stock according to procedures as indicated by oldest product being utilized first. Orders food and supplies based upon product specification as established by company ordering protocols and procedures. Secures designated areas of potential theft, dangerous chemicals, supplies and equipment to safeguard associates. Follows all security procedures regarding storeroom organization. Transports food and supplies in appropriate containers or vehicles as indicated to ensure food or supplies arrive safely and intact. Follows HACCP guidelines when receiving and distributing food supplies to ensure quality and safety of food supply. Reports needed maintenance or repairs of equipment used to proper resources. Completes all daily, weekly or monthly reports as outlined in the corporate policies and procedures on a timely basis meeting all prescribed deadlines. Identifies and utilizes cleaning chemicals following directions recommended by manufacturers and per MSDS sheets. Utilizes equipment in performing job functions according to department safety procedures. Performs other duties as assigned.

    Marcel is located in the iconic Breuer building on Madison Avenue, a Roman and Williams–designed space created in partnership with Sotheby’s where cuisine, art, and design converge. Led by Chef-Partner Marie-Aude Rose and Executive Chef Juan Moncalvo, the restaurant serves refined continental cuisine rooted in French tradition and inspired by Chef Rose’s homage to the Paris she knows and loves. The menu blends classical technique with modern New York sensibilities, focusing on seasonality and highlighting carefully sourced local ingredients with minimal, thoughtful enhancement.


    We are developing skilled culinary craftsmen and women who want to grow in their careers and strive for excellence. Often described as the “big brother” to downtown favorite La Mercerie, Marcel also features a celebrated pâtisserie program with handcrafted viennoiserie, madeleines, tarts, and entremets. The experience unfolds in a striking, design-forward space with an open kitchen, sculptural dining room, garden terrace, museum-quality art, and a wine program drawn from Sotheby’s cellar, all supporting Marcel’s mission to be a culinary destination of excellence in New York City.

    Upscale French cuisine downtown NYC. The very talented Executive Chef Heloïse Fischbach balances classical training with avant-garde technique in a thoughtful reimagining of seasonal French cuisine at this downtown gem linked to the Romain and Williams interior design store.
